Intracontinental subduction: a possible mechanism for the Early Palaeozoic Orogen of SE China
International audienceThe Early Palaeozoic Orogen of SE China consists of three litho-tectonic elements, from top to bottom: a sedimentary Upper Unit, a metamorphic Lower Unit and a gneissic basement.
